Calcium or Uric Acid? Know Your Stone Type for the Right Treatment
A frequent and excruciating urological ailment that affects people of all ages is kidney stones. However, not all kidney stones are the same. The two most common types—calcium stones and uric acid stones—require different approaches to treatment and prevention. For long-term relief and efficient management, it is essential to understand your stone type.

Why Identifying Your Stone Type Matters
Kidney stone treatment is not “one-size-fits-all.”
Each stone type forms due to different metabolic or dietary factors. Treating a calcium stone like a uric acid stone—or vice versa—may lead to recurrence and complications.
Accurate diagnosis helps:
-
Choose the right treatment method
-
Prevent stone recurrence
-
Reduce pain and hospital visits
-
Improve kidney health long-term
Understanding Calcium Kidney Stones
Calcium stones are the most common type of kidney stones, usually made of calcium oxalate or calcium phosphate.
Causes of Calcium Stones:
-
High oxalate intake (spinach, nuts, chocolates)
-
Dehydration
-
Excess salt intake
-
Metabolic disorders
-
Certain medications
Symptoms:
-
Severe flank or back pain
-
Blood in urine
-
Burning sensation while urinating
-
Nausea or vomiting
Treatment Approach:
-
Increased water intake
-
Dietary modifications
-
Medications to reduce calcium or oxalate levels
-
Minimally invasive procedures like laser stone removal if needed
What Are Uric Acid Stones?
Uric acid stones form due to high uric acid levels in the urine and are more common in people with gout or metabolic syndrome.
Causes of Uric Acid Stones:
-
High-protein diet
-
Low urine pH (acidic urine)
-
Dehydration
-
Obesity
-
Diabetes
Symptoms:
Symptoms are similar to calcium stones but often recur if untreated.
Treatment Approach:
-
Alkalizing the urine
-
Reducing uric acid levels with medications
-
Lifestyle and dietary changes
-
Avoiding purine-rich foods

Preventing Future Kidney Stones
No matter the stone type, prevention is key:
-
Drink 2.5–3 liters of water daily
-
Maintain a balanced diet
-
Reduce salt and processed foods
-
Follow medical advice strictly
-
Regular follow-ups with a urologist
